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el Review

The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el Made a Bold First Impression

The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el promises a simple, yet vital role: securely attaching a sling to your firearm. It’s a blackened stainless steel, industry-standard sized (1 inch) push-button sling swivel from Troy Industries. Real-World Testing: Putting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el to the Test

First Use Experience

I initially tested the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el on my AR-15 during a three-day carbine course. This put the swivel through its paces with constant transitions, sling adjustments, and general handling under simulated stress. The weather was mixed, with sunshine, light rain, and dusty conditions throughout the course.

The swivel performed flawlessly. The push-button was easy to actuate, even with gloved hands, allowing for quick detachment and reattachment of the sling. I experienced no binding or sticking, and the swivel rotated smoothly, preventing sling twist.

No issues arose during that initial carbine course. The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el performed exactly as expected, providing a secure and reliable sling attachment point. It was a positive first impression, validating my initial assessment of its build quality.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of consistent use, including multiple range trips, a hunting excursion, and even some impromptu backyard drills, the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el continues to impress. It has become a permanent fixture on my primary rifle. There are no signs of wear or tear beyond some minor cosmetic scratches on the black finish.

The stainless steel construction has proven its worth. The swivel hasn’t shown any signs of rust or corrosion despite exposure to sweat, rain, and cleaning solvents. Maintenance is simple; a quick wipe down with a lightly oiled cloth is all it takes to keep it functioning smoothly.

Compared to previous, less expensive swivels, the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el is in a different league. It inspires confidence and removes a potential point of failure from my gear. It has completely outperformed my expectations, especially considering its relatively low price.

Breaking Down the Features of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el

Specifications

The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el features blackened stainless steel construction for enhanced durability and corrosion resistance. It’s designed with an industry-standard 1-inch loop, compatible with most slings on the market. The push-button mechanism allows for quick and easy attachment and detachment.

The 1-inch loop is crucial for compatibility, ensuring it works with the vast majority of slings. The stainless steel construction directly translates to longevity and reliability, especially in harsh environments. The push-button mechanism facilitates rapid sling adjustments and weapon manipulations.

Accessories and Customization Options

The Troy Black S.S. Q.D. Swivel doesn’t come with any included accessories, as it is a self-contained component. It’s designed to be compatible with a wide range of sling mounting options, including rails, receivers, and stocks with Q.D. (Quick Detach) sockets. This compatibility is a significant advantage.

The swivel is universally compatible with any firearm that accepts industry-standard Q.D. sling swivels. It integrates seamlessly with slings from various brands, offering versatility in gear selection.
